College: COLLEGE OF HUMANITIES AND SOCIAL SCIENCE Department: COMMUNICATION SCIENCES & DISORDERS Credits: 3.00 Advanced Phonetics. Prerequisites: Graduate major in Communication Sciences and Disorders, Speech-Language Pathology concentration. Skill in use of phonetics in recognizing and distinguishing acceptable English speech sounds, deviant speech sounds, regional variations in standards of American English and sounds in foreign languages. Stress, phrasing and intonation patterns used in speaking English, with some analysis of these elements in other languages. 3 hours lecture.
